Meiji is a wonderful restaurant - I love that they have small plates of cooked dishes, such as pork katsu in a broth with onions and egg (sort of a rice-less donburi), braised hamachi cheek, and little skewers of ground chicken kabobs (three, each with its own delicious sauce). The hostess and server were both very friendly, and the decor is serene.
